Your Ad Here
首页 | 编程语言 | 网站建设 | 游戏天堂 | 冲浪宝典 | 网络安全 | 操作系统 | 软件时空 | 硬件指南 | 病毒相关 | IT 认证
软讯网络 > 编程语言 > .NET > C#.NET > 犯了一个巨ft的错误,指责一下编译器。
【标  题】:犯了一个巨ft的错误,指责一下编译器。
【关键字】:ft
【来  源】:http://realfun.cnblogs.com/archive/2005/11/26/284827.html

犯了一个巨ft的错误,指责一下编译器。

Your Ad Here error C2533: 'xxx::{ctor}' : constructors not allowed a return type

找了半天没发现有构造函数有返回值啊,Google了一下,找到答案,原来在.h文件里面定义的时候少了一个分号:
http://www.gamedev.net/community/forums/topic.asp?topic_id=124341

看了其中的争论,首先是为什么要有个分号,这是沿用C中的语法,定义一个类,紧接着就定义一个变量,然后分号。

个人觉得,这种情况可以cut了,就像最后一个帖子所说的那样,很久没有见过定义一个类紧跟着定义一个变量的了。

还有就是,即便这么做是合适的,为什么编译器在预编译的时候不给出一个warning,说你这个.h头文件里面class漏了分号,而要跑到.cpp文件里面才去报这个令人摸不着头脑的 C2533的错误信息?不是尽量靠近出事地点么
文件快搜(Quick File Locator) v0.1发布,中文、英文版,by yuchifang:【上一篇】
关于VIM - 进行有效编辑的七种习惯 zz:【下一篇】
【相关文章】
  • Microsoft Office InfoPath 2003 Toolkit for Visual Studio .NET
  • Test Your Knowledge of Microsoft Visual Studio .NET
  • 解决“System.Data.Odbc.OdbcException: ERROR [IM001] [Microsoft][ODBC 驱动程序管理器] 驱动程序不支持此...
  • 推荐一款自动编译工具Visual Build Professional和一本书《Coder To Developer -- Tools and Strategies fo...
  • Microsoft treeview background problem.
  • Microsoft's online virtual lab
  • 刚刚收到来至 Reliasoft Corporation 的一封版权申明信
  • softice 在winice中的安装 zt
  • Microsoft SQL Reporting Services – Running a Report from the Command Line
  • 终于快忙出头了,开了个FTP给大家用[mikespook]
  • 【随机文章】
  • 通用线程: 高级文件系统实现者指南,第 6 部分
  • 有效防御病毒的十大必作的步骤
  • 可爱的 Python:Python 中的函数编程
  • 探訪CISCO總部照片
  • 菜鸟教程:文件关联从入门到精通
  • Photoshop制作残损的墙壁
  • ByteArrayOutputStream的使用
  • 第三章 数组的解剖学
  • LINUX操作命令汇总
  • 2006信息技术会考复习(理论复习)
  • 【相关评论】
    没有相关评论
    【发表评论】
    姓名:
    邮件:
    随机码*
    评论*
          
    |  首 页  |  版权声明  |  联系我们   |  网站地图  |
    CopyRight © 2004-2007 bbb软讯网络 All Rigths Reserved.